Today's photo comes from the USC Fisher Museum of Art where I intern. Our staff is hard at work on our new exhibition, "Triumph of Phillippine Art." The exhibition comes to us from George Segal Gallery in New Jersey and was to show at the Ayala Museum in Manila. Bit because of displacement caused by the recent typhoons, "Triumph" needed to keep traveling and so it came to us. I'm excited about the convergence I art and culture as the exhibition features artistic responses to martial law in the Philippines and subsequent revolution!
